Well, I've found it:

IPC > Up Shift Indication (Manuel Transmission)
IPC > Down Shift Indication (Manuel Transmission)

Both on Disabled

(One can effectively disable separately the upshift and downshift indicators.)

It works on my 2020 Bullitt.
